Florida’s legal gambling scene consists of a mix of brick-and-mortar racinos and a tribal monopoly on other forms of gambling, held by the Seminole Tribe. 

In-person poker is available at the racinos and at the Seminoles’ two Hard Rock Casinos in Hollywood and Tampa. There is no regulated online poker, though sweepstakes poker rooms serve the state.

For several years, Florida was in focus in sports betting legal news, due to a federal challenge to its hub-and-spoke interpretation of the Indian Gambling Regulatory Act. The state granted the Seminoles exclusivity over online sports betting statewide, using the logic that bets “take place” on tribal land as long as the servers are hosted there. That case ended with Florida sports betting intact, setting an important precedent for gaming tribes around the country as they look to move operations online.
